Balancing Seasonal Decor and Staging to Sell | RedKey Realty Leaders

Ready to list your home among St. Louis homes for sale? With the holidays fast approaching, you'll want to keep decorations tasteful and appealing. You want your space to feel warm and inviting, but you also need to ensure festive touches don't distract from your home's best features or overwhelm potential buyers. Striking the right balance between seasonal style and staging can help your home stand out and avoid lingering on the market.

The Foundation: Staging Comes First

Your home needs a solid staging foundation before you think about adding seasonal elements. Strategic staging creates a neutral canvas for potential buyers to picture themselves in the space, no matter the time of year. This involves removing personal items, arranging furniture to improve flow, and giving each room a clear purpose. After you set this base, you can add seasonal touches that boost, not distract from, your home's natural appeal.
